Summary
A French-speaking Governess is needed in London to help both their school-aged children practice the language. They have hired an au pair in the past, but they now need someone who will help bring a routine. An educational background is a bonus for this role. Live-out candidates may apply. A French speaker is a must.
A valid first aid qualification is a requirement for this position.
Working hours: Monday to Friday - 40 hours
Accommodation: Own bedroom
Duties include:
Bathing and maintaining proper hygiene for the children.,
Ensuring the safety, well-being, and development of the children.,
Engaging the children in interactive play, educational activities, and outdoor outings such as visits to the park.,
Encouraging early literacy by reading books to the children.,
Providing homework assistance and supporting the children’s educational growth.,
Establishing and maintaining consistent daily routines to support the children's structure and development.,
Keeping children's bedrooms and play areas clean, organised, and tidy.,
Preparing and serving nutritious meals and snacks tailored to the children
They seek someone who can start in September 2025.
